tpudrv12.h: FCDEV3B goes back to being itself A while back we had the idea of a FreeCalypso modem family whereby our current fcdev3b target would some day morph into fcmodem, with multiple FC modem family products, potentially either triband or quadband, being firmware-compatible with each other and with our original FCDEV3B. But in light of the discovery of Tango modules that earlier idea is now being withdrawn: instead the already existing Tango hw is being adopted into our FreeCalypso family. Tango cannot be firmware-compatible with triband OM/FCDEV3B targets because the original quadband RFFE on Tango modules is wired in TI's original Leonardo arrangement. Because this Leonardo/Tango way is now becoming the official FreeCalypso way of driving quadband RFFEs thanks to the adoption of Tango into our FC family, our earlier idea of extending FIC's triband RFFE control signals with TSPACT5 no longer makes much sense - we will probably never produce any new hardware with that once-proposed arrangement. Therefore, that triband-or-quadband FCFAM provision is being removed from the code base, and FCDEV3B goes back to being treated the same way as CONFIG_TARGET_GTAMODEM for RFFE control purposes.

/**** DIONE TIMERs configuration register ****/

#define D_TIMER_ADDR        0xfffe3800

#define D_TIMER_CNTL_MASK	0x001f

#define CNTL_D_TIMER_OFFSET	0x0000
#define LOAD_D_TIMER_OFFSET	0x0002
#define READ_D_TIMER_OFFSET	0x0004

#define D_TIMER_CNTL		(D_TIMER_ADDR+CNTL_D_TIMER_OFFSET)
#define D_TIMER_LOAD		(D_TIMER_ADDR+LOAD_D_TIMER_OFFSET)
#define D_TIMER_READ		(D_TIMER_ADDR+READ_D_TIMER_OFFSET)

#define D_TIMER_ST		0x0001		/* bit 0 */
#define D_TIMER_AR		0x0002		/* bit 1 */
#define D_TIMER_PTV		0x001c		/* bits 4:2 */
#define D_TIMER_CLK_EN		0x0020		/* bit 5  */
#define D_TIMER_RUN		0x0021		/* bit 5 ,0 */

#define LOAD_TIM		0xffff		/* bits 15:0 */





/* ----- Prototypes ----- */
SYS_UWORD16 Dtimer1_Get_cntlreg(void);

void Dtimer1_AR(SYS_UWORD16 Ar);

void Dtimer1_PTV(SYS_UWORD16 Ptv);

void Dtimer1_Clken(SYS_UWORD16 En);

void  Dtimer1_Start (SYS_UWORD16 startStop);

void Dtimer1_Init_cntl (SYS_UWORD16 St, SYS_UWORD16 Reload, SYS_UWORD16 clockScale, SYS_UWORD16 clkon);

void Dtimer1_WriteValue (SYS_UWORD16 value);

SYS_UWORD16 Dtimer1_ReadValue (void);
